Creates the player_meta table (gogobee_legacy_migration.md §2.1) with the three columns L2 needs: arena_wins, arena_losses, invasion_score. Future phases ALTER in their own columns. Naming follows the §2.0 callout — no dnd_ prefix on new tables. Helpers in internal/plugin/player_meta.go: loadPlayerMeta, upsertPlayerMetaArena, backfillPlayerMetaArena (INSERT OR IGNORE, idempotent, logs row count per Phase R1 precedent). Plugin Init runs the backfill once on startup. Dual-write per §11: every char.ArenaWins++/ArenaLosses++ in adventure_arena.go also calls upsertPlayerMetaArena. AdvCharacter columns stay in place — reads will switch back to AdvCharacter trivially if a rollback is needed before L5 teardown. Read swap: handleArenaStats and renderDnDSheet now load player_meta and prefer its values (falling back to AdvCharacter if the row is missing, which only matters during the deploy window before backfill runs). renderArenaPersonalStats's signature changed from (char, stats) to (displayName, wins, losses, stats) so the render is DB-free. Tests: TestPlayerMetaArenaBackfill_Idempotent verifies double-run backfill is a no-op and doesn't clobber post-backfill dual-writes; TestUpsertPlayerMetaArena_RoundTrip covers insert/update/missing-user paths.
